Put mine in on the weekend. Not too difficult, the guy is really helpful and responds quickly.

 

I like the bigger screen, looks ok to me even though it sticks out a bit. Makes it easier to interact with.

 

The reverse camera does not work yet - he has not decoded the wiring loom on the mk2 for the camera yet. I might try and tap into it myself. Otherwise everything else works. 

 

Also using Agama interface and have a usb sim for data. Have not got the android auto dongle working yet, need to download something from a dodgy web address onto the unit.

 

The bluetooth phone interface is diabolically rudimentary. No text messages and no voice control/calling. Will have to find an alternate app...
